Economic impact analysis In FY 2020-21, ICC added $21.2 million in income to the ICC Service Area1 economy, a value approximately equal to 1.8% of the region’s total gross regional product (GRP). Expressed in terms of jobs, ICC’s impact supported 502 jobs. For perspective, the activities of ICC and its students support one out of every 35 jobs in the ICC Service Area.
